Jackson Speech & Language Services is a speech therapist in Stoughton, MA. The practice provides individualized, evidence-based speech and language evaluations and therapy to help children thrive. Serving children from birth to eighteen years old, the clinic specializes in the evaluation and treatment of mild to severe pediatric communication disorders as well as pediatric feeding disorders. The practice holds a 5.00 rating based on 9 reviews.
The practice was established in 2008 and is led by Director Annette Jackson, MS, CCC-SLP, who brings over twenty years of professional experience working with children with special needs in clinical, educational, and daycare settings. The clinic offers comprehensive evaluations using standardized testing, parent interviews, and observations, followed by customized treatment plans. Beyond individual therapy, the center provides play-based social groups to help children build social pragmatic skills and foster positive peer relationships. Additionally, therapists provide consultations to families and professionals to support a child's progress outside of the therapy room.
